>> On 03/26/19 14:09, Igor Mammedov wrote:
>>> For testcase to use UEFI firmware, one needs to provide and specify
>>> firmwarei and varstore blobs names in test_data { uefi_fl1, uefi_fl2) }
>>> fields respectively and RAM start address plus size where to look for
>>> test structure signature. Additionally testcase should specify
>>> bootable cdrom image uefi-boot-images EFI test utility.
>>>
>>> Signed-off-by: Igor Mammedov <address@hidden>
>>> ---
>>> v3:
>>> * drop data_dir prefix and firmware will come from pc-bios directly
>>> * add cdrom option so test could use it for providing boot cdrom image
>>> v2:
>>> * move RAM start address and size to test_data, as it could differ
>>> between boards (and even versions)
>>> ---
>>> tests/bios-tables-test.c | 40 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++----------
>>> 1 file changed, 30 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)

>> Reviewed-by: Laszlo Ersek <address@hidden>
>>
>> Later on, we should convert the "-drive if=pflash" options to the new
>> syntax (see commit e33763be7cd3). However, I think that syntax doesn't
>> work for the aarch64/virt board yet. (Should we file a Launchpad item
>> about this, as a reminder?)
> I tend not to use LP (last time was in 2015) so I'm not sure if it would
> be of any help. Maybe adding a TODO comment in code would be better.
